Output 88c28dd0bdada6259d574c36a546973f83ffe2c291bdfdb95ad444cdf196692e:2

value
20263953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32cab80916dce9b440aeb766d4c91fe93cf9b31b OP_EQUAL
address
MCXisBDmHzQeodaXcde7zidSbCGcGZATsi
transaction
88c28dd0bdada6259d574c36a546973f83ffe2c291bdfdb95ad444cdf196692e
spent
true